About 750 persons to benefit from National Youth Employment Programme

Mankranso (Ash), Aug 03, GNA – About 750 persons in the Ahafo-Ano South District are to benefit from the National Youth Employment Programme when it takes off in the district this year.

Jobs will be created in sanitation, community protection, rural teaching assistance, auxiliary health assistance and agriculture. Addressing a cross section of the beneficiaries at Mankranso on Tuesday, Mr Frank Kwarteng, the District Co-ordinator of the Programme, stressed the need for competence, integrity and industriousness on the part of the employees.

He said the programme was initiated to reduce poverty and improve the standards of living of the rural people.
